Most of the time I managed to stick with writing code and documentation. At rare weak moments I am pursuaded to write articles about aspects of SWI-Prolog or its libraries. If you use SWI-Prolog and write academic publications, please consider citing one of these papers. The TPLP paper SWI-Prolog is the preferred `general purpose reference' BibTeX.

new.gif My PhD thesis, titled Logic programming for knowledge-intensive interactive applications (4.4MB) contains revised versions of most of the above papers supplemented with a broader overview of applying Prolog for the development of large-scale applications. BibTeX
